Beyond just strolling along the shore, which is always a must, I highly recommend exploring a bit further. For sheer natural beauty and a feeling of getting away from it all, Damon Point is incredible. It's a fantastic spot for birdwatching, hunting for unique shells and driftwood, or simply sitting and watching the ocean meet Grays Harbor. The quiet solitude there often helps me clear my head. For those who love a more active experience, renting a moped or a bicycle and cruising along the paved path that runs parallel to the beach is a fantastic way to see the town and feel the ocean breeze. It's one of my go-to Ocean Shores activities when I need to shake off some stress. You can even venture into the town center, where you'll find quirky souvenir shops and delightful local eateries. Speaking of food, you absolutely have to try the fresh seafood – there are some hidden gems that serve up the best clam chowder! Evenings in Ocean Shores can be just as magical. If you're looking for a peaceful beach at night experience, grab a blanket and head to the sand for some stargazing. Away from the city lights, the night sky can be breathtaking, offering a different kind of calm. Sometimes, just listening to the rhythmic crash of the waves in the darkness brings a profound sense of tranquility. For a bit of local flavor and learning, the Ocean Shores Interpretive Center (or North Beach Museum, depending on what you're looking for) offers a glimpse into the area's history and ecology. It's a nice change of pace if the weather isn't cooperating or if you want a break from the beach. There’s also miniature golf, which can be a fun, lighthearted distraction if you're with family or friends.
